Shrub pruning is a important practice for keeping healthy, appealing shrubs while managing their shapes and size. Pruning removes dead, damaged, or diseased branches, motivates brand-new growth, and promotes flowering or fruiting. Each shrub species may have particular pruning requirements, consisting of timing, cut placement, and method. The process involves examining the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ning thick locations to enhance airflow and light penetration. Seasonal considerations guarantee that pruning does not interfere with flowering cycles or stress the plant during critical development durations. Constant shrub pruning improves both aesthetic appeal and plant health. Proper care permits shrubs to keep a well balanced form, grow in the landscape, and contribute favorably to the general style of the outdoor area
